The only thing I can think of at this point is to try installing Haali's Matroska splitter. That's the only reason I can think of as to why WMP6.4 won't recognize it even with ffdshow set correctly.

The latest version is available here (although it's also available from the previous link I gave to the current ffdshow builds):
http://haali.cs.msu.ru/mkv/

During the setup, make sure that AVI is unchecked.
